Sungrow SBR Battery Specs

Specification Details
Energy Capacity (per module) 3.2 kWh
Usable Capacity Range 6.4 to 25.6 kWh (Per Stack)
Continuous Power Output Up to 7.6 kW
Battery Chemistry Lithium Iron Phosphate (LFP)
Operating Temperature -10°C to 50°C
Depth of Discharge 100%
Cycle Life More than 6000 cycles
IP Rating IP55 (indoor or outdoor use)
Warranty 10 years
Scalability 2 to 8 modules per stack. Up to 4 stacks in total
Compatibility Works with Sungrow hybrid inverters (SHRS and SHT)

 

The SBR battery connects directly with Sungrow hybrid inverters, creating a simple and efficient solar battery system that can grow over time.

What Are Modular Batteries?

A modular battery uses smaller units that work together as one system. This makes it flexible because you can start with a lower capacity and expand as your power needs grow. The Sungrow SBR follows this design, which gives it great long-term value and adaptability.

How Does the SBR Compare to the Tesla Powerwall 3?

Both the Sungrow SBR and the Tesla Powerwall 3 are excellent home batteries. The Powerwall 3 includes a built-in inverter and has a fixed 13.5 kWh capacity. It can be expanded with the Tesla Powerwall 3 Expansion Pack, reaching up to 54 kWh.

The Sungrow SBR, on the other hand, offers more flexibility thanks to its modular setup. It can start as small as 6.4 kWh and expand to 25.6 kWh per stack. It also connects directly to Sungrow hybrid inverters, which often means lower installation costs.

In short:

  • Sungrow SBR suits homes that want affordable and flexible storage.
  • Tesla Powerwall 3 suits homes that prefer an all-in-one, high-power setup.

Both are reliable choices, and the best option depends on your home and goals.

How Does Solar Energy Work?

We can all see solar panels mounted on roofs generating electricity to power homes and businesses, but not everyone may understand the process of how they work.

Solar panels feature photovoltaic (PV) cells that capture sunlight and convert it to electricity. When sunlight hits a solar panel, the cells generate a flow of electrons, creating an electric current in the panel.

However, the electricity generated is in DC (direct current) and cannot power home appliances until it is converted to AC (alternating current) power. For example, your fridge, lights, and machinery only run on AC. This is why the generated power is fed to an inverter, which converts it into alternating current for home and business uses.

This process similarly applies to other solar products like solar roof ventilation and solar skylights. Each system has an array of solar cells that convert solar energy into electricity.

However, while this explains how solar panels generate electricity and inverters convert it for home use, there is another component in the room that is worth acknowledging: solar battery storage. A complete solar power system extends to battery storage, which is essential for storing unused energy. Excess energy generated during the day can be stored in solar batteries or fed to the grid for money. More on solar batteries shortly.

Can I Use Solar Energy at Night?

One question we have received multiple times over the years of our experience is whether it is possible to use solar energy at night.

Of course, the sun sets, and when it does, the solar panels go idle. However, your solar system doesn’t have to leave you stranded at night when you probably need it the most. With a solar battery storage system, using your solar energy around the clock is achievable. Here is how you can upgrade your solar power system for more hours of use, especially on cloudy days and at night:

Solar Batteries

Solar batteries are connected to solar panels and inverters to store excess energy generated during the day for later use in the evening or on cloudy days. The unused power from the inverter charges the battery during the day. At night, the battery discharges to power your appliances. Investing in solar batteries helps households maximise savings by offering free energy at night when the sun has gone to rest or during outages.

How Much Energy They Can Store

Each SBR module stores about 3.2 kWh of energy. Most households choose between 6.4 and 25.6 kWh worth of modules, which is usually enough to run the essentials through the night.

The SBH is a different story, as each stack can go up to around 40 kWh. That’s a significant amount of energy which is perfect if you’re charging an EV, running ducted air, or powering business machinery.

Can You Add More Later

Yes, both are modular systems.

With the SBR, you can start with a smaller setup and add more modules later without too much hassle.

The SBH also scales up easily, and it’s designed to handle bigger stacks and higher power outputs. So if you plan to expand your system down the track, Sungrow makes that fairly straightforward.

What’s Inside (Battery Chemistry)

Both models use Lithium Iron Phosphate (LFP) cells, a safe and stable chemistry that performs well in Australian conditions.

These batteries don’t overheat easily, and they can handle years of daily use without major degradation. LFP technology is also known for its long cycle life, which means more years of solid performance.
